Sad news to report today from Oskaloosa, Iowa. Former great Iowa Hawkeye Football player Tyler Sash has died. No details have been released on the cause of his death.

Sash, 27, starred for Oskaloosa High School as a multi-sport athlete before committing to Iowa to play football for the Hawkeyes. Tyler decided to forgo his senior season at Iowa and was drafted in the 6th round of the 2011 NFL draft to the New York Giants. He played in Super Bowl XLVI when the Giants defeated the New England Patriots 21-17.

Though not confirmed, it appears that Kirk Ferentz' weekly press conference has been postponed due to Sash's death. At 1:40 this afternoon, the University of Iowa Sports Information Department released this statement: "Due to a private issue regarding the Iowa football program, unrelated to game preparation, Coach Ferentz’ weekly press conference has been rescheduled for 2:15 p.m., CT, on Wednesday, Sept. 9."
